Comparative Performance Evaluation of Magnetron Sputtered TiN, AlCrN, and TiAlCrN Coatings
Baitsi Montwedi,
Samson Jeje,
Mxolisi Shongwe
Abstract:This study presents a comparative performance evaluation of magnetron-sputtered TiN, AlCrN, and TiAlCrN coatings on tool steel substrates. Coatings play a pivotal role in enhancing the durability of engineering components exposed to harsh conditions. TiN is known for outstanding hardness and durability, AlCrN for superior wear resistance, and TiAlCrN for exceptional thermal stability and oxidation resistance.
